Art Deco Influence on Bedroom Design

Art Deco, that became popular in the 20s and 30s, still amazes with its bold geometric forms and rich materials. The Art Deco bed frames remain an excellent amalgamation between exuberance and smoothness. One will most often find very detailed patterns, gold and silver finishes, and very dark exotic wood, all meant to produce an air of opulence and class.

Art Deco Bed Frame Features:

  • Geometric Shapes: The Art Deco bed frames are characterized by bold shapes, zigzag, and chevron patterns. These forms make the bed very strong to the eye and assist in creating a point of focus in the room.
  • Luxurious Materials: Mirror-surfaced and luxurious finishes such as high-gloss lacquer, and even the use of glass as an accent are frequent elements of Art Deco bed designs.
  • Metallic Finishes: Gold, silver, and chrome finishes are Art Deco staples, which make the bed frame glamorous.
  • Pedestal: Pedestals have the benefit of being very fashionable and being able to raise your table.

Art Deco bed frames can make a statement while still harmonizing with various decor styles, from contemporary to more classical.

2. Think Before Your Color Scheme

When considering a Manhattan bed furniture design, look at neutral color tones with splashes of rich neutrals like navy, charcoal, or emerald green. Art Deco bed frames are accessorized with deep jewel hues, so royal blue, ruby red, and deep black go perfectly with the elaborate designs and finishes throughout the furniture. A proper color scheme is the one that will add coherence to the aesthetic design of your room.

3. Enhance High-End Materials and Textures

Whether it's the soft opulence of the Art Deco bed frame or the subtle luxury of the Manhattan bed, textures can make a significant contribution. Art Deco beds will be made more luxurious with the use of velvet, silk, and satin bedding, and the soft textured linens and the softness of wool blankets will enhance the comfort of beds in Manhattan.

4. Stress on Lighting

Lighting plays a permanent role in setting the proper mood. In both styles, softer, ambient light works fine, but you might want to employ a more elegant version like a crystal chandelier to bring an Art Deco feeling into play, or something sleek and modern like a pendant light over your Manhattan bed, in the contemporary case. Make sure that the lighting is also a fit for the design of the bed and brings out the luxurious features.
